bfgminer.exe -o http://api.bitcoin.cz:8332 -u username.worker1 -p password --disable-gpu -S all

Okay, so I received a Block Erupter today. I bought it because I like being an active part of the network, and that I can now do so without killing a GPU in the process.  No delusions that I'll earn back the cost.

I've been using GPUMiner with my videocard until now, and moving over to BFGMiner, I *don't* want the program to utilize my GPU *and* the Block Erupter - only the latter.

Is there something on the command line to do that?
